During the Clinton administration, The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act, also known as the Gramm-Leach-Bliley Financial Services Modernization Act, (Pub.L. 106-102, 113 Stat. 1338, enacted November 12, 1999) was an Act of the 106th United States Congress (1999-2001) which repealed part of the Glass-Steagall Act of 1933, opening up competition among banks, securities companies and insurance companies. The Glass-Steagall Act prohibited any one institution from acting as both an investment bank and a commercial bank, or as both a bank and an insurer.

    This allowed banks to be exposed to the more risky ventures of insurance and leasing and investment banking.

    Also under Clinton, in Dec 2000, he signed leglistaion that exempted derivatives like credit default swaps, which banks sold to each other to "insure" their mortgage backed securities. By insuring them, they were able to reduce the asset base against which they had to keep monetary reserves. The only problem was that the mortgage backed securities that had high subprime content and were rated AAA were not really AAA and began to sour. Since the banks were tethered together by the credit default swaps and had reduced their reserves, they got caught without enough capital when things went bad and the whole thing would have come down because they were holding each other's CDS's
